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,106 @@
// Copyright (c) Microsoft Corporation. All rights reserved.
// Licensed under the MIT license. See LICENSE file in the project root for full license information.

namespace Microsoft.VisualStudio.TestPlatform.CrossPlatEngine.Client
{
using System;
using System.Collections.Generic;
using System.Linq;
using System.Threading.Tasks;
using Microsoft.VisualStudio.TestPlatform.Common.ExtensionFramework;
using Microsoft.VisualStudio.TestPlatform.ObjectModel;
using Microsoft.VisualStudio.TestPlatform.ObjectModel.Client;
using Microsoft.VisualStudio.TestPlatform.ObjectModel.Engine;
using Microsoft.VisualStudio.TestPlatform.ObjectModel.Engine.TesthostProtocol;
using Microsoft.VisualStudio.TestPlatform.ObjectModel.Host;
using Microsoft.VisualStudio.TestPlatform.ObjectModel.Logging;

internal class InProcessProxyDiscoveryManager : IProxyDiscoveryManager
{
private ITestHostManagerFactory testHostManagerFactory;
private IDiscoveryManager discoveryManager;
private ITestRuntimeProvider testHostManager;
public bool IsInitialized { get; private set; } = false;

/// <summary>
/// Initializes a new instance of the <see cref="InProcessProxyDiscoveryManager"/> class.
/// </summary>
public InProcessProxyDiscoveryManager(ITestRuntimeProvider testHostManager) : this(testHostManager, new TestHostManagerFactory())
{
}

/// <summary>
/// Initializes a new instance of the <see cref="InProcessProxyDiscoveryManager"/> class.
/// </summary>
/// <param name="testHostManagerFactory">Manager factory</param>
internal InProcessProxyDiscoveryManager(ITestRuntimeProvider testHostManager, ITestHostManagerFactory testHostManagerFactory)
{
this.testHostManager = testHostManager;
this.testHostManagerFactory = testHostManagerFactory;
this.discoveryManager = this.testHostManagerFactory.GetDiscoveryManager();
}

/// <summary>
/// Initializes test discovery.
/// </summary>
public void Initialize()
{
}

/// <summary>
/// Discovers tests
/// </summary>
/// <param name="discoveryCriteria">Settings, parameters for the discovery request</param>
/// <param name="eventHandler">EventHandler for handling discovery events from Engine</param>
public void DiscoverTests(DiscoveryCriteria discoveryCriteria, ITestDiscoveryEventsHandler eventHandler)
{
Task.Run(() =>
{
try
{
// Initialize extension before discovery
this.InitializeExtensions(discoveryCriteria.Sources);
this.discoveryManager.DiscoverTests(discoveryCriteria, eventHandler);
}
catch (Exception exception)
{
EqtTrace.Error("InProcessProxyDiscoveryManager.DiscoverTests: Failed to discover tests: {0}", exception);

// Send a discovery complete to caller.
eventHandler.HandleLogMessage(TestMessageLevel.Error, exception.ToString());
eventHandler.HandleDiscoveryComplete(-1, Enumerable.Empty<TestCase>(), true);
}
}
);
}

/// <summary>
/// Closes the current test operation.
/// This function is of no use in this context as we are not creating any testhost
/// </summary>
public void Close()
{
}

/// <summary>
/// Aborts the test operation.
/// </summary>
public void Abort()
{
Task.Run(() => this.testHostManagerFactory.GetDiscoveryManager().Abort());

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,143 @@
// Copyright (c) Microsoft Corporation. All rights reserved.
// Licensed under the MIT license. See LICENSE file in the project root for full license information.

namespace Microsoft.VisualStudio.TestPlatform.CrossPlatEngine.Client
{
using System;
using System.Collections.Generic;
using System.Collections.ObjectModel;
using System.Linq;
using System.Threading.Tasks;
using Microsoft.VisualStudio.TestPlatform.Common.ExtensionFramework;
using Microsoft.VisualStudio.TestPlatform.ObjectModel;
using Microsoft.VisualStudio.TestPlatform.ObjectModel.Client;
using Microsoft.VisualStudio.TestPlatform.ObjectModel.Engine;
using Microsoft.VisualStudio.TestPlatform.ObjectModel.Engine.ClientProtocol;
using Microsoft.VisualStudio.TestPlatform.ObjectModel.Engine.TesthostProtocol;
using Microsoft.VisualStudio.TestPlatform.ObjectModel.Host;
using Microsoft.VisualStudio.TestPlatform.ObjectModel.Logging;

internal class InProcessProxyExecutionManager : IProxyExecutionManager
{
private ITestHostManagerFactory testHostManagerFactory;
private IExecutionManager executionManager;
private ITestRuntimeProvider testHostManager;
public bool IsInitialized { get; private set; } = false;

/// <summary>
/// Initializes a new instance of the <see cref="InProcessProxyexecutionManager"/> class.
/// </summary>
public InProcessProxyExecutionManager(ITestRuntimeProvider testHostManager) : this(testHostManager, new TestHostManagerFactory())
{
}

/// <summary>
/// Initializes a new instance of the <see cref="InProcessProxyexecutionManager"/> class.
/// </summary>
/// <param name="testHostManagerFactory">
/// Manager factory
/// </param>
internal InProcessProxyExecutionManager(ITestRuntimeProvider testHostManager, ITestHostManagerFactory testHostManagerFactory)
{
this.testHostManager = testHostManager;
this.testHostManagerFactory = testHostManagerFactory;
this.executionManager = this.testHostManagerFactory.GetExecutionManager();
}

/// <summary>
/// Initialize adapters.
/// </summary>
public void Initialize()
{
}

/// <inheritdoc/>
public int StartTestRun(TestRunCriteria testRunCriteria, ITestRunEventsHandler eventHandler)
{
try
{
// This code should be in sync with ProxyExecutionManager.StartTestRun executionContext
var executionContext = new TestExecutionContext(
testRunCriteria.FrequencyOfRunStatsChangeEvent,
testRunCriteria.RunStatsChangeEventTimeout,
inIsolation: false,
keepAlive: testRunCriteria.KeepAlive,
isDataCollectionEnabled: false,
areTestCaseLevelEventsRequired: false,
hasTestRun: true,
isDebug: (testRunCriteria.TestHostLauncher != null && testRunCriteria.TestHostLauncher.IsDebug),
testCaseFilter: testRunCriteria.TestCaseFilter);
